bubu~, it is normal for babies to seek comfort sucking. But it isn't the most beneficial for mummy's rest to allow them to just suckle when they aren't drinking. To preserve the sanity of your nipples, let her suck on your little finger. That should do the trick as well. It's a precious tip from the lac'con that has preserved my sanity while I prepare my breast or warm up a top-up feed. I let him suckle my finger to keep him from crying in the meantime.

*Edited: finger should be nail on baby's tongue and pad on the roof of mouth. Insert up to second knuckle. It is apparently also a way of training baby to suck. bubu,I think you should put Sophie on this training regime to improve her suckling efficiency by sustaining and strengthening her suckle.</font>
Re: Warm compress vs Cold
Do note that the chilled cabbage treatment is more to relieve painful engorgement and not a permanent solution. It kinda holds things back for a brief respite from the rock-hardness, so that you can express a little and start latching baby on again. Warm compresses (or in my case, hot boob massages in the shower) work everytime as they improve the flow and help clear up blocked ducts. So this is something that you can (and should) use time and time again - with or without painful engorgement. It improves milk flow for baby and makes things easier for him/her. I hope this clarifies things somewhat.
